Take a Network Break! Our Red Alert covers a trio of vulnerabilities in Cisco ISE.
On the news front, Cloudflare announces a private network offering for AI agents and a partnership with CNAPP specialist Wiz for AI visibility. AWS rolls out Interconnect to streamline provisioning of WAN and last-mile connectivity, and Linux 7.0 includes network upgrades including default support for AccECN.
OpenAI blames energy costs and regulations for halting planned data center expansion in the UK, Netgear and AdTran score unexplained exemptions from the FCC ban on routers produced fully or partly outside the US, and Microsoft launches a new agent for deeper network visibility in Kubernetes.
Chipmaking bellwethers ASML and TSMC see revenue rise in Q1 and forecast continued growth, and Amazon buys mobile satellite provider Globalstar to bulk up its orbital fleet as it chases Starlink.
